The Gallery, Martinsburg, WV Local Guide

Largest Available The Gallery 2 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in the The Gallery area of Martinsburg, WV is found at The Reserve at Berkeley and is listed at 1,440 square feet priced from $1,845.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in the area:

Apartment ListingModel NameSquare FootagePriced From
The Reserve at BerkeleyTwo Bedroom Townhome1,440 Sq Ft$1,845
Linden at Elmtree2 Bedroom 1.5 Bath975 Sq Ft$1,600
Spring Mills Gardens2B900 Sq Ft$1,599
Linden at BerkeleyThe Spruce860 Sq Ft$1,500
Spring Mills ApartmentsTwo Bedroom826 Sq Ft$1,600

Cheapest Available The Gallery 2 Bedroom Apartments

Currently the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it The Gallery of Martinsburg, WV is the Two Bedroom Model starting from $767 at Rumsey Terrace.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in The Gallery is currently $1,518.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in the area:

Apartment ListingModel NamePriced From
Rumsey TerraceTwo Bedroom$767
Oak Tree Village2 Bedroom 1 Bathroom$782
Joshua Gardens Apartments2 Beds, 1 bath$1,060
Linden at BerkeleyThe Spruce$1,500
Spring Mills Gardens2B$1,599

Quick Rent Budget Calculator

How much rent can you afford?

The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
